The export files belongs there as it is the artifact which we build upon when we add new questions.

Basically to update a survey you need to take that artifact, upload it into your personal instance, edit according to the updated markdown file, fetch again and reupload here. It is a manual process, but that's what we came up with with Marie and for now it works, just slowly.
